Romanians came out to vote on 6 and 7 October in a referendum to change the constitution to officially define marriage as between one man and one woman. However, not enough Romanians came out. The referendum needed 30% of the population to show up to be valid, but although the vote was extended to two days, only about 20% of registered voters actually cast ballots. Die Nationale Kirchenversammlung der Rumänischen Orthodoxen Kirche hat die Bürger des Landes dazu aufgerufen, am bevorstehenden Referendum über die Ehe Ja zu stimmen. Mit dem Referendum soll die Definition der Ehe in der rumänischen Verfassung abgeändert werden, wo sie bisher als eine freiwillig eingegangene Verbindung zwischen Ehepartnern bezeichnet wird. Falls das Referendum angenommen wird, hieße es in der Verfassung künftig „Verbindung zwischen Mann und Frau“.

Monday, September 3, 2018, from 09:45 to 10:30 a.m., His Beatitude Patriarch Daniel officiated the blessing service of the National Cathedral’s six bells on the ground. Consequently, the bells will be mounted together with their metallic structure in the Bell Tower on the western façade of the new Patriarchal Cathedral, at a height of 60 meters. The Romanian Orthodox Church has released a statement calling for “prayer, peace, dialogue, and social co-responsibility” against the backdrop of several days of protests in Bucharest that have left more than 450 injured. Some estimates say 100'000 people came out to the streets of the capital for several days starting on 10 August 2018 to protest what they see as government corruption and to call for new elections. About 95% of the Romanian citizens believe in God, but only 21% go to church every week, says a survey on the religious belief in Romania, conducted by Friedrich Ebert Romania Foundation, cited by Agerpres. According to the same study, 27% of the Romanians say the referendum to re-define the family concept is necessary. Holy Friday has become an official public non-working holiday in Romania. With Romanian President Klaus Iohannis’ signature on the completion of Paragraph 1 of Article 139 of the Labor Code, Romania joined 16 other EU countries where Holy Friday is already a public holiday. The bill was initiated by Deputy Szabo Odon of the Democrat Hungarian Union and adopted by the Senate on February 21 by a vote of 86-1 with one abstention. In 2017, the Romanian Orthodox Church invested approximatively 24 million Euros in charity work. 'Currently the Romanian Orthodox Church is the greatest philanthropist in terms of ist contribution to social work', said Patriarch Daniel during the meeting of the National Church Assembly (NCA) stressing that this means 'sacrifice, effort, and caring for the people'.
